Abstract

Pyrazole derivatives of Formula (Ia) and pharmaceutical compositions thereof that modulate the activity of the serotonin 5HT 2A receptor. Formula (Ia). Compounds and pharmaceutical compositions thereof are directed to methods useful in the treatment of insomnia and related sleep disorders, platelet aggregation, coronary artery disease, myocardial infarction, transient ischemic attack, angina, stroke, atrial fibrillation, reducing the risk of blood clot formation, asthma or symptoms thereof, agitation or symptoms thereof, behavioral disorders, drug induced psychosis, excitative psychosis, Gilles de la Tourette's syndrome, manic disorder, organic or NOS psychosis, psychotic disorders, psychosis, acute schizophrenia, chronic schizophrenia, NOS schizophrenia and related disorders, diabetic-related disorders, progressive multifocal leukoencephalopathy and the like. The present invention also relates to the methods for the treatment of 5-IIT 2A serotonin receptor mediated disorders in combination with other pharmaceutical agents administered separately or together.

1 . A compound of Formula (Ia): 
       
         
           
           
               
               
           
         
         or a pharmaceutically acceptable salt, solvate or hydrate thereof; 
       
       wherein:
 R 1  and R 2  are each independently selected from the group consisting of H, C 1 -C 6  alkyl, C 1 -C 6  alkylaryl, aryl, C 3 -C 7  cycloalkyl, C 1 -C 6  haloalkyl, halogen, heteroaryl, and nitro; and wherein C 1 -C 6  alkyl, aryl and heteroaryl are optionally substituted with 1, 2, 3, 4 or 5 substituents selected independently from the group consisting of C 1 -C 6  acyl, C 1 -C 6  acyloxy, C 2 -C 6  alkenyl, C 1 -C 6  alkoxy, C 1 -C 6  alkyl, C 1 -C 6  alkylcarboxamide, C 1 -C 6  alkylsulfonamide, C 1 -C 6  alkylsulfinyl, C 1 -C 6  alkylsulfonyl, C 1 -C 6  alkylthio, C 1 -C 6  alkylureyl, C 1 -C 6  alkylamino, C 2 -C 6  alkynyl, amino, carbo-C 1 -C 6 -alkoxy, carboxamide, carboxy, cyano, C 3 -C 7  cycloalkyl, C 2 -C 6  dialkylamino, C 2 -C 6  dialkylcarboxamide, C 2 -C 6  dialkylsulfonamide, C 1 -C 6  haloalkoxy, C 1 -C 6  haloalkyl, C 1 -C 6  haloalkylsulfinyl, C 1 -C 6  haloalkylsulfonyl, C 1 -C 6  haloalkylthio, halogen, hydroxyl, nitro, sulfonamide and thiol; or 
 R 1  and R 2  together with the carbon atoms to which they are bonded form a C 3 -C 7  carbocyclyl or a C 3 -C 7  heterocyclyl group each optionally substituted with 1, 2, 3, 4 or 5 substituents selected independently from the group consisting of C 1 -C 6  acyl, C 1 -C 6  acyloxy, C 2 -C 6  alkenyl, C 1 -C 6  alkoxy, C 1 -C 6  alkyl, C 1 -C 6  alkylcarboxamide, C 1 -C 6  alkylsulfonamide, C 1 -C 6  alkylsulfinyl, C 1 -C 6  alkylsulfonyl, C 1 -C 6  alkylthio, C 1 -C 6  alkylureyl, C 1 -C 6  alkylamino, C 2 -C 6  alkynyl, amino, carbo-C 1 -C 6 -alkoxy, carboxamide, carboxy, cyano, C 3 -C 7  cycloalkyl, C 2 -C 6  dialkylamino, C 2 -C 6  dialkylcarboxamide, C 2 -C 6  dialkylsulfonamide, C 1 -C 6  haloalkoxy, C 1 -C 6  haloalkyl, C 1 -C 6  haloalkylsulfinyl, C 1 -C 6  haloalkylsulfonyl, C 1 -C 6  haloalkylthio, halogen, hydroxyl, nitro, oxo, sulfonamide and thiol; 
 R 3  is selected from the group consisting of H, C 1 -C 6  alkyl and aryl; and wherein aryl is optionally substituted with 1, 2, 3, 4 or 5 substituents selected independently from the group consisting of C 1 -C 6  acyl, C 1 -C 6  acyloxy, C 2 -C 6  alkenyl, C 1 -C 6  alkoxy, C 1 -C 6  alkyl, C 1 -C 6  alkylcarboxamide, C 1 -C 6  alkylsulfonamide, C 1 -C 6  alkylsulfinyl, C 1 -C 6  alkylsulfonyl, C 1 -C 6  alkylthio, C 1 -C 6  alkylureyl, C 1 -C 6  alkylamino, C 2 -C 6  alkynyl, amino, carbo-C 1 -C 6 -alkoxy, carboxamide, carboxy, cyano, C 3 -C 7  cycloalkyl, C 2 -C 6  dialkylamino, C 2 -C 6  dialkylcarboxamide, C 2 -C 6  dialkylsulfonamide, C 1 -C 6  haloalkoxy, C 1 -C 6  haloalkyl, C 1 -C 6  haloalkylsulfinyl, C 1 -C 6  haloalkylsulfonyl, C 1 -C 6  haloalkylthio, halogen, hydroxyl, nitro, sulfonamide and thiol; 
 A and X are each —CH 2 CH 2 —, each optionally substituted with 1, 2, 3 or 4 substituents selected independently from the group consisting of C 1 -C 4  alkoxy, C 1 -C 3  alkyl, carboxy, cyano, C 1 -C 3  haloalkyl, halogen, hydroxyl and oxo; 
 J is —CH 2 CH 2 — or —C(═NOMe)CH 2 — each optionally substituted with 1, 2, 3 or 4 substituents selected independently from the group consisting of C 1 -C 4  alkoxy, C 1 -C 3  alkyl, carboxy, cyano, C 1 -C 3  haloalkyl, halogen, hydroxyl and oxo; and 
 Ar is aryl or heteroaryl each optionally substituted with 1, 2, 3, 4 or 5 substituents selected independently from the group consisting of C 1 -C 6  acyl, C 1 -C 6  acyloxy, C 2 -C 6  alkenyl, C 1 -C 6  alkoxy, C 1 -C 6  alkyl, C 1 -C 6  alkylcarboxamide, C 1 -C 6  alkylsulfonamide, C 1 -C 6  alkylsulfinyl, C 1 -C 6  alkylsulfonyl, C 1 -C 6  alkylthio, C 1 -C 6  alkylureyl, C 1 -C 6  alkylamino, C 2 -C 6  alkynyl, amino, carbo-C 1 -C 6 -alkoxy, carboxamide, carboxy, cyano, C 3 -C 7  cycloalkyl, C 2 -C 6  dialkylamino, C 2 -C 6  dialkylcarboxamide, C 2 -C 6  dialkylsulfonamide, C 1 -C 6  haloalkoxy, C 1 -C 6  haloalkyl, C 1 -C 6  haloalkylsulfinyl, C 1 -C 6  haloalkylsulfonyl, C 1 -C 6  haloalkylthio, halogen, C 3 -C 7  heterocyclyl, hydroxyl, nitro, sulfonamide and thiol; provided that said compound is other than: 
 1-(4-(1H-pyrazole-3-carbonyl)piperazin-1-yl)-2-(4-fluoro-1H-indol-3-yl)ethane-1,2-dione.

         27 . A pharmaceutical composition comprising a compound according to  claim 1  and a pharmaceutically acceptable carrier. 
     
     
         28 . A method for treating a 5-HT 2A  mediated disorder in an individual comprising administering to said individual in need thereof a therapeutically effective amount of a compound according to  claim 1 . 
     
     
         29 . The method according to  claim 28 , wherein said 5-HT 2A  mediated disorder is selected from the group consisting of coronary artery disease, myocardial infarction, transient ischemic attack, angina, stroke, and atrial fibrillation. 
     
     
         30 . A method for treating a sleep disorder in an individual comprising administering to said individual in need thereof a therapeutically effective amount of a compound according to  claim 1 . 
     
     
         31 . The method according to  claim 30 , wherein said sleep disorder is a dyssomnia. 
     
     
         32 . The method according to  claim 30 , wherein said sleep disorder is insomnia. 
     
     
         33 . The method according to  claim 30 , wherein said sleep disorder is a parasomnia. 
     
     
         34 . A method for increasing slow wave sleep in an individual comprising administering to said individual in need thereof a therapeutically effective amount of a compound according to  claim 1 . 
     
     
         35 . A method for improving sleep consolidation in an individual comprising administering to said individual in need thereof a therapeutically effective amount of a compound according to  claim 1 . 
     
     
         36 . A method for improving sleep maintenance in an individual comprising administering to said individual in need thereof a therapeutically effective amount of a compound according to  claim 1 .
